Essential Smoker Costume Components



To truly capture the essence of Smoker from One Piece, it's essential to focus on the key components of his costume. The first notable element is the iconic white trench coat. Smoker's coat is a significant part of his character design, featuring an open front and a high collar. When selecting a coat, look for one that has a slightly oversized fit and is made from a durable fabric to mimic the anime's look. The lightweight material is crucial for comfort, especially during conventions or events where you may wear the costume for extended periods.



Next, the pants play a critical role in achieving an accurate Smoker cosplay. He typically wears dark-colored pants that are practical for a marine officer. Look for comfortable cargo or military-style pants that provide a good balance between style and functionality. one piece smoker cosplay should be relaxed to match Smoker’s rugged appearance, and ensure they are long enough to sit comfortably over your footwear. This choice will help reinforce the militaristic vibe that is central to Smoker's character.



Lastly, accessories are important to complete the Smoker look. The character carries his signature jutte, a baton-like weapon, which is essential for any serious Smoker cosplay. Additionally, consider adding any unique details like an emblem of the Marines on your costume, as well as a pair of fingerless gloves to establish a more authentic feel. Pay attention to the details of the accessories, as they help create a cohesive and impressive portrayal of Smoker and elevate your cosplay to the next level.



Makeup and Props for Authenticity



To achieve a true One Piece Smoker cosplay, start with the makeup that captures his distinct look. Smoker is known for his pale complexion, so using a foundation that matches this tone is essential. Adding some light contouring to accentuate the cheekbones can enhance the character's rugged appearance. The most identifiable feature of Smoker is his cigar, so consider incorporating a realistic-looking prop cigar to emphasize this signature trait.



Next, focus on the eyes. Smoker has dark, intense eyes that reflect his serious demeanor. Use a black eyeliner to create a subtle wing and add some definition. You can also consider using colored contact lenses in dark hues to mimic his eye color more closely. Completing the makeup with a bit of silver eyeshadow will help reflect a smoky look, resonating with his name and the use of smoke in his abilities.



For props, the most important item is Smoker's signature jitte, which is a type of baton. This prop not only represents his authority as a Marine officer but is also integral to his fighting style. You can create or purchase a jitte that is lightweight yet detailed, ensuring it looks accurate to the anime. Pairing this with accessories like a Marine coat or any additional themed props will enhance the authenticity of your Smoker cosplay, making it stand out at any event.



Tips for Performing as Smoker



To truly embody Smoker from One Piece, focus on his confident demeanor and commanding presence. Practice adopting a strong posture, maintaining a relaxed yet assertive stance while interacting with others. Smoker is known for his no-nonsense attitude, so conveying that seriousness in your expression can help bring the character to life. Engage with your audience or fellow cosplayers by mimicking his signature gestures, like crossing your arms or pointing dramatically.



Incorporate the character's distinctive traits into your performance.
